Let Secret Washington DC guide you around the unusual and unfamiliar.

Step off the beaten track with this fascinating Washington guide book and let our local experts show you over 140 well-hidden treasures of this amazing city. Ideal for local inhabitants and curious visitors alike, here you can find:

  • a Darth Vader gargoyle on a church
  • a giant chair
  • the longest escalator in the western hemisphere
  • a faithful replica of the Holy Land for those who cannot make the pilgrimage to Jerusalem
  • a fence forged from War of 1812 muskets
  • the oldest continually operating airport in the world
  • the only embassy state in the nation

Far from the crowds and the usual cliches, Washington DC is a reserve of well-concealed treasures only revealed to those who know how to wander off the beaten track, whether resident or visitor.

Acerca del autor

Born at the University Hospital named for old George himself, Sharon Pendana left Washington after high school to pursue her fashion dreams in New York City where she unearthed sartorial treasures and created narratives through wardrobe for print, television and film. She launched The Trove to profile some of the fascinating creatives she encountered along the way. Returning to DC to care for her ailing mother, she set about to rediscover her hometown, uncovering hidden gems and sharing their back stories, just as she always has.
